Donating

Thank you for considering a donation to the Fund for the Diaconate. For the past several years, the Fund has been working more closely with our sister organization, the Association for Episcopal Deacons (AED). That work has included such activities as sharing the costs of a booth at General Convention, sending representatives to each other’s board meetings, and working in concert to explain the diaconate to the Church Pension Fund and others.

In 2016, the two groups agreed to hire The Cornerstone Group (led by Deacon Lisa Bennett) to do an analysis for a potential fund-raising campaign that would allow the Fund and AED to do more for deacons in The Episcopal Church. That report, which both boards accepted, recommended that the Fund concentrate on planned giving and large donations, and that AED concentrate on an annual campaign and increasing membership.
